Transaction 20539371031f2749b2ebbccd42f1111632803fea6817330aa6e9ae377d4d5eb8

1 Input
2 Outputs
  • 20539371031f2749b2ebbccd42f1111632803fea6817330aa6e9ae377d4d5eb8:0
  • value  4903892
    address  1HsfPDB9PFZj5Tc8yAtyErg35B9Wni75MA
  • 20539371031f2749b2ebbccd42f1111632803fea6817330aa6e9ae377d4d5eb8:1
  • value  63065556
    address  1QFLjXYQWLryqoZXn4ZzCvXnETEqpEPvNS